Dewani At Airport To Fly Home After Being Cleared Of Murdering Bride

Shrien Dewani has arrived at a Cape Town airport to fly back home to Britain after being dramatically cleared of murdering his bride on their honeymoon. Dewani was found not guilty yesterday after Cape Town High Court judge Jeanette Traverso ruled that the prosecution's case did not have sufficient evidence to convict him. The millionaire businessman, who arrived at the airport looking relaxed and flanked by members of his family, is believed to be boarding an Emirates flight to Dubai.
